2025-08-20 10:23:17 Sql:delete from base_bizcolumnattach where AccessPath='GB_PlanDoc' and keyvalue='508008999' and datacolumnid='002202' Error:事务(进程 ID 63)与另一个进程被死锁在 锁 | 通信缓冲区 资源上,并且已被选作死锁牺牲品。请重新运行该事务。 在 System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) 在 System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) 在 System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) 在 System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ady) 在 System.Data.SqlClient.SqlCommand.RunExecuteNonQueryTds(String methodName, Boolean async, Int32 timeout, Boolean asyncWrite) 在 System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(TaskCompletionSource`1 completion, String methodName, Boolean sendToPipe, Int32 timeout, Boolean& usedCache, Boolean asyncWrite, Boolean inRetry) 在 System.Data.SqlClient.SqlCommand.ExecuteNonQuery() 在 Redsoft.DatabaseProvider.DbAccess.Execute(String sql) 位置 D:\MyProduct\GMIS2020\DatabaseProvider\DbAccess.cs:行号 443 concreteDbConn状态:Open 2025-08-20 10:23:38 Sql:select count(*) from ( SELECT DISTINCT 人员信息表.ID as [~ID~] ,人员信息表.[AuditorCode] AS [人员编号],人员信息表.[AuditorName] AS [人员姓名],人员信息表.[Mobile] AS [手机号],[性别_代码表].CodeName AS [性别],[所在省份_省份].Province AS [所在省份],[专兼职_代码表].CodeName AS [专兼职],人员信息表.[EmploymentDate] AS [聘用日期],[聘用状态_代码表].CodeName AS [聘用状态],人员信息表.[Education] AS [学历],[职称_职称].TitleName AS [职称],人员信息表.[ProfessionalTitle] AS [职称专业],[组织机构_组织机构].OrgName AS [组织机构],人员信息表.[BirthDay] AS [出生日期],人员信息表.[IDCard] AS [证件号码],人员信息表.[DismissalDate] AS [解聘日期],人员信息表.[UpdateOn] AS [修改时间] FROM GB_Auditor 人员信息表 WITH(NOLOCK) LEFT JOIN Pub_Code [性别_代码表] WITH(NOLOCK) ON 人员信息表.Gender = [性别_代码表].CodeID LEFT JOIN Pub_Province [所在省份_省份] WITH(NOLOCK) ON 人员信息表.Province = [所在省份_省份].ProvinceCode LEFT JOIN Pub_Code [专兼职_代码表] WITH(NOLOCK) ON 人员信息表.WorkType = [专兼职_代码表].CodeID LEFT JOIN Pub_Code [聘用状态_代码表] WITH(NOLOCK) ON 人员信息表.StaffStatus = [聘用状态_代码表].CodeID LEFT JOIN Pub_DutyTitle [职称_职称] WITH(NOLOCK) ON 人员信息表.DutyTitle = [职称_职称].TitleCode LEFT JOIN Base_Org [组织机构_组织机构] WITH(NOLOCK) ON 人员信息表.Org = [组织机构_组织机构].OrgID LEFT JOIN Pub_IDCardClass [证件类型_证件类型] WITH(NOLOCK) ON 人员信息表.IDCardClass = [证件类型_证件类型].ClassCode LEFT JOIN GB_AuditorRegister [注册与保持] WITH(NOLOCK) ON 人员信息表.AuditorCode = [注册与保持].AuditorCode WHERE ((([注册与保持].[Org] = '2102' OR [人员信息表].[IsPublic] =1))) AND ((EXISTS (SELECT 1 FROM GB_AuditorRegister WHERE [人员信息表].auditorcode = GB_AuditorRegister.auditorcode AND standardcode = '60') AND EXISTS (SELECT 1 FROM GB_AuditorRegister WHERE [人员信息表].auditorcode = GB_AuditorRegister.auditorcode AND standardcode = '65')) and ( [人员信息表].AuditorName like '%张亚萍%' and ([人员归属_领域归属].[OSName] like '%三体系人员%') and ([聘用状态_代码表].[CodeName] like '%未聘%'))) ) as CurrentCount Error:无法绑定由多个部分组成的标识符 "人员归属_领域归属.OSName"。 在 System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) 在 System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) 在 System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) 在 System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ady) 在 System.Data.SqlClient.SqlDataReader.TryConsumeMetaData() 在 System.Data.SqlClient.SqlDataReader.get_MetaData() 在 System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String, Boolean isInternal, Boolean forDescribeParameterEncryption, Boolean shouldCacheForAlwaysEncrypted) 在 System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async, Int32 timeout, Task& task, Boolean asyncWrite, Boolean inRetry, SqlDataReader ds, Boolean describeParameterEncryptionRequest) 在 System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, TaskCompletionSource`1 completion, Int32 timeout, Task& task, Boolean& usedCache, Boolean asyncWrite, Boolean inRetry) 在 System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method) 在 System.Data.SqlClient.SqlCommand.ExecuteReader(CommandBehavior behavior, String method) 在 System.Data.SqlClient.SqlCommand.ExecuteDbDataReader(CommandBehavior behavior) 在 System.Data.Common.DbCommand.System.Data.IDbCommand.ExecuteReader(CommandBehavior behavior) 在 System.Data.Common.DbDataAdapter.FillInternal(DataSet dataset, DataTable[] datatables,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) 在 System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) 在 System.Data.Common.DbDataAdapter.Fill(DataSet dataSet) 在 Redsoft.DatabaseProvider.DbAccess.Query(String sql) 位置 D:\MyProduct\GMIS2020\DatabaseProvider\DbAccess.cs:行号 207 concreteDbConn状态:Open 2025-08-20 10:23:46 Sql:select count(*) from ( SELECT DISTINCT 人员信息表.ID as [~ID~] ,人员信息表.[AuditorCode] AS [人员编号],人员信息表.[AuditorName] AS [人员姓名],人员信息表.[Mobile] AS [手机号],[性别_代码表].CodeName AS [性别],[所在省份_省份].Province AS [所在省份],[专兼职_代码表].CodeName AS [专兼职],人员信息表.[EmploymentDate] AS [聘用日期],[聘用状态_代码表].CodeName AS [聘用状态],人员信息表.[Education] AS [学历],[职称_职称].TitleName AS [职称],人员信息表.[ProfessionalTitle] AS [职称专业],[组织机构_组织机构].OrgName AS [组织机构],人员信息表.[BirthDay] AS [出生日期],人员信息表.[IDCard] AS [证件号码],人员信息表.[DismissalDate] AS [解聘日期],人员信息表.[UpdateOn] AS [修改时间] FROM GB_Auditor 人员信息表 WITH(NOLOCK) LEFT JOIN Pub_Code [性别_代码表] WITH(NOLOCK) ON 人员信息表.Gender = [性别_代码表].CodeID LEFT JOIN Pub_Province [所在省份_省份] WITH(NOLOCK) ON 人员信息表.Province = [所在省份_省份].ProvinceCode LEFT JOIN Pub_Code [专兼职_代码表] WITH(NOLOCK) ON 人员信息表.WorkType = [专兼职_代码表].CodeID LEFT JOIN Pub_Code [聘用状态_代码表] WITH(NOLOCK) ON 人员信息表.StaffStatus = [聘用状态_代码表].CodeID LEFT JOIN Pub_DutyTitle [职称_职称] WITH(NOLOCK) ON 人员信息表.DutyTitle = [职称_职称].TitleCode LEFT JOIN Base_Org [组织机构_组织机构] WITH(NOLOCK) ON 人员信息表.Org = [组织机构_组织机构].OrgID LEFT JOIN Pub_IDCardClass [证件类型_证件类型] WITH(NOLOCK) ON 人员信息表.IDCardClass = [证件类型_证件类型].ClassCode LEFT JOIN GB_AuditorRegister [注册与保持] WITH(NOLOCK) ON 人员信息表.AuditorCode = [注册与保持].AuditorCode WHERE ((([注册与保持].[Org] = '2102' OR [人员信息表].[IsPublic] =1))) AND ((EXISTS (SELECT 1 FROM GB_AuditorRegister WHERE [人员信息表].auditorcode = GB_AuditorRegister.auditorcode AND standardcode = '60') AND EXISTS (SELECT 1 FROM GB_AuditorRegister WHERE [人员信息表].auditorcode = GB_AuditorRegister.auditorcode AND standardcode = '65')) and ( [人员信息表].AuditorName like '%张亚萍%' and ([人员归属_领域归属].[OSName] like '%三体系人员%') and ([聘用状态_代码表].[CodeName] like '%在聘%'))) ) as CurrentCount Error:无法绑定由多个部分组成的标识符 "人员归属_领域归属.OSName"。 在 System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) 在 System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) 在 System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) 在 System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ady) 在 System.Data.SqlClient.SqlDataReader.TryConsumeMetaData() 在 System.Data.SqlClient.SqlDataReader.get_MetaData() 在 System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String, Boolean isInternal, Boolean forDescribeParameterEncryption, Boolean shouldCacheForAlwaysEncrypted) 在 System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async, Int32 timeout, Task& task, Boolean asyncWrite, Boolean inRetry, SqlDataReader ds, Boolean describeParameterEncryptionRequest) 在 System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, TaskCompletionSource`1 completion, Int32 timeout, Task& task, Boolean& usedCache, Boolean asyncWrite, Boolean inRetry) 在 System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method) 在 System.Data.SqlClient.SqlCommand.ExecuteReader(CommandBehavior behavior, String method) 在 System.Data.SqlClient.SqlCommand.ExecuteDbDataReader(CommandBehavior behavior) 在 System.Data.Common.DbCommand.System.Data.IDbCommand.ExecuteReader(CommandBehavior behavior) 在 System.Data.Common.DbDataAdapter.FillInternal(DataSet dataset, DataTable[] datatables,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) 在 System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) 在 System.Data.Common.DbDataAdapter.Fill(DataSet dataSet) 在 Redsoft.DatabaseProvider.DbAccess.Query(String sql) 位置 D:\MyProduct\GMIS2020\DatabaseProvider\DbAccess.cs:行号 207